About Lorrian
Lorrian, a name steeped in history, offers a captivating blend of strength and elegance. While some sources suggest a feminine name of English origin, others point to an Irish origin with a meaning rich in valor. The latter interpretation highlights "noble warrior" or "brave leader," suggesting a child destined for courage and leadership. This evokes images of a fearless individual, ready to defend what is right.
Despite its relatively uncommon usage, Lorrian carries a timeless appeal. Its history suggests it has been bestowed upon newborns for decades, adding a layer of subtle charm. The absence of widely known meanings allows for the freedom to create a unique identity associated with the name. It is a name that resonates with strength and nobility, making it a memorable choice.

Nickname Ideas
- Lori: It's a classic and easy-to-say nickname that flows effortlessly off the tongue. You can use it for everyday situations and it's just as sweet as the full name.
- Lorry: This nickname adds a bit of a playful twist to Lorrian. It's a fun and quirky option that still feels connected to the original name.
- Rian: This nickname highlights the unique sound of the middle part of the name, creating a fresh and modern feel. It's a little bit unexpected, which makes it even more charming.
- Lora: You can use this nickname for a more elegant and sophisticated feel. It's a beautiful and timeless option that suits both young and older Lorrians.
- Lorrie: It's a cute and friendly nickname that brings a touch of warmth to the name. You could use it for a sweet and bubbly Lorrian.
